Who qualifies for Wegovy

Our EU-licensed doctors assess each patient individually to determine if Wegovy (semaglutide) is an appropriate treatment. Generally, Wegovy is prescribed for adults with a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 kg/m² or greater (obesity), or a BMI of 27 kg/m² or greater (overweight) with at least one weight-related comorbidity such as high blood pressure, type 2 diabetes, or high cholesterol. The doctor will evaluate your full medical history, current health conditions, and any other medications you are taking to ensure your safety and treatment effectiveness. Certain conditions, like a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or Multiple Endocrine Ne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2), are contraindications.

What Wegovy actually does (and doesn't do)

Wegovy is a GLP-1 receptor agonist containing semaglutide. It works by mimicking a natural hormone that targets areas of the brain involved in appetite regulation, leading to reduced hunger and increased feelings of fullness. This can help you eat less and lose weight. It's important to understand that Wegovy is a tool to support weight loss when used alongside a reduced-calorie diet and increased physical activity, not a standalone 'miracle drug.' Realistic weight loss occurs over time, and consistent lifestyle changes are crucial for long-term success. It does not provide instant results or eliminate the need for healthy habits.

Side effects and when to stop

Like all medications, Wegovy can cause side effects. Common side effects often include nausea, diarrhoea, vomiting, constipation, and abdominal pain. These are usually mild to moderate and tend to decrease over time as your body adjusts to the medication. Less common but more serious side effects can occur, such as pancreatitis, gallbladder problems, or kidney issues. It's crucial to discuss any concerning symptoms with your doctor immediately. If you experience severe abdominal pain, persistent vomiting, or yellowing of the skin or eyes, you should seek urgent medical attention and stop using Wegovy.
